基本上我有6张图片和6个文本链接到他们
我做过css悬停在图片上(彩色版本-> on hover ->黑白版本)
和文本链接(悬停->上的黑色字体->和红色字体)
当我在链接上悬停时-图片正在获得悬停版本(B&W),这是可以的,但这只在这个方向上起作用,当我在图片上悬停时,在相反的方向上-文本链接保持不变(黑色字体)
这就是我的问题,如何将这两个元素(文本链接和图片)连接起来?
下面是我的代码:
HTML
<ul class="menu">
li class="element_1"><a href
我有三个目标与这些照片,隐藏所有除了第一个。当鼠标悬停在第一张图片上时,显示所有的图片,当鼠标悬停在第一张图片上时,继续显示。隐藏图片一次,仅当再次悬停在第一张上方时才显示该区域。(我忘记了img源代码,但它们在代码中)为了始终如一地做到这一点,我编写了html、css和js代码,但我只能实现两个,而不是全部三个,重复地没有刷新。代码: var tog = document.querySelector('#toggle');
var glide = document.querySelector('#first')
glide.onmouseover =
因此,我使用了jquery插件fancybox,并使其正常工作,但我想知道如何对其进行一些调整。下面是我的html:
<a id="pics" title="This is some text that displays" href="Images/test.jpg">
<img alt="pics" src="Images/test.jpg"/></a>
$("a#pics").fancybox({
openEffect : 'elastic&
所以我有这个php脚本,它输出一个html表,其中包含一些文件的数据(如文件名、文件大小等)。
我有一个javascript函数,当你悬停一个属于“预览”类的标签时,它会显示图片。例如,如果文件名为: somePic.jpg,当您将鼠标悬停在表中的somePic.jpg上时,该图片将出现在鼠标旁边。
现在并不是所有这些文件都是图片,有些是.mp3,所以当你悬停它们时,javascript不能显示图片。为了处理这种情况,我在标记(由javascript函数生成)中添加了一个alt属性: alt='Preview not available for this content.‘’。
这就是
我使用一个函数将图片添加到一个站点。这些进入到DIV中,使用.html()在完成之后,我需要同样的图像来显示悬停的效果,但是当我将它们悬停时什么都不会发生。如果我键入在.html()函数、相同类等中使用的相同代码,则悬停工作。
经过多次尝试,我把我的问题缩小到了这个样本。问题在于容器DIV如何公开通过.html()添加的代码.我的悬停函数找不到动态添加的标签。
下面是我的示例代码:
<html>
<head>
<title>Problems</title>
<script type ="text/javascript" sr
编辑:我解决了这个问题,我使整个图像成为一个链接,并将图片上的文本(以前的链接)放入- pointerevents: none。这样我就实现了我想要的东西。 I put image, im hovering over the link that is colored, I want the corresponding picture (top left) to remove grayscale我在页面上有图片,当你将鼠标悬停在它们上面时,它们会从灰度变成正常的彩色图片。默认情况下,它们被视为灰度。 然后我在那个页面上也有链接。我做的是,当我将鼠标悬停在链接1id上时,就像图片1一样,从灰度变